Failing unit tests on Jenkins build

      There are four unit tests that fail because of an ordering issue with JsonArray. Locally these all pass successfully, but when running on Jenkins CI, they fail.

      The output from Jenkins looks like this:

      shouldInjectCredentialsFromPairs
      expected:<{"creds":[\{"user":"bar","pass":"b"},\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"}]}>
      but was:<{"creds":[\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"},\{"user":"bar","pass":"b"}]}>
      shouldInjectCredentialsFromCredentialList
      expected:<{"creds":[\{"user":"bar","pass":"b"},\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"}]}>
      but was:<{"creds":[\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"},\{"user":"bar","pass":"b"}]}>
      shouldReplaceSameLoginCredentials
      expected:<{"creds":[\{"user":"bar","pass":"c"},\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"}]}>
      but was:<{"creds":[\{"user":"foo","pass":"a"},\{"user":"bar","pass":"c"}]}>
      testGetConfigureBucketPayload
      expected:<...se, customSettings={[foo=bar, baz=123]}}">
      but was:<...se, customSettings={[baz=123, foo=bar]}}">
